New Delhi: Music composer Pritam Chakraborty, who is making his Bollywood comeback through Salman Khan-starrer "Bajrangi Bhaijaan", says keeping the star cast aside, it's the music of a film that draws the audience to theatres.

"I think once the music (of a film) is a hit, more than half the battle is won for a filmmaker. Music is definitely very important in the success of the film. Apart from the star cast, in Bollywood, music is what draws people to the theatre in the first place. Music sums up the impression of the film to a great extent," Chakraborty told IANS.
